    Best Time To Visit Mahabaleshwar

    Plan your trip during best season to experience the best of this stunning destination

    Mahabaleshwar is Maharashtra’s most beloved hill station.

    Famous for its strawberry farms, the scenic beauty of Mahabaleshwar knows no bounds. Picturesque views of the Krishna and Koyna valleys, boating on the Venna Lake, sunsets at Wilson Point, and the numerous other attractions of Mahabaleshwar are sure to steal your heart. Each season is delightful and peels back a new layer on the loveliness of this hill town. Visitors make their pilgrimage to Mahabaleshwar at all times of the year for a wholesome vacation. Winters are perfect for couples and honeymooners. The hills have a distinct romantic charm and cosiness to them. Summer is the best time to visit Mahabaleshwar with family and adventure-loving friends. Nature is in full bloom, and the weather is perfect for exploration and sightseeing. Trekkers will find Mahabaleshwar exquisite at this time of year. The monsoon season is the off-season for tourism since it can impede travel plans and outdoor excursions, but the rains rejuvenate the soil, and a fresh scent infuses the air. It is a beautiful time to visit Mahabaleshwar if you can handle some rain.

    Climate in Mahabaleshwar

    Summer Season in Mahabaleshwar

    Summer is the shoulder season in Mahabaleshwar. The city's hills make a lovely summer retreat for visitors from all over the plains of Maharashtra and India. Families spend their summer vacations here and leave with a sense of awe and bittersweet memories. While the sun is warm, it never gets uncomfortable. The temperature fluctuates between 17 and 32 degrees Celsius, and the region receives little to no rainfall. The weather is perfect for trekking, seeing sunrises at Monkey Point, renting bicycles and taking a tour of the city, and visiting the lake for a Shikara ride.

    Monsoon Season in Mahabaleshwar

    On the Koppen scale, the hill station is classified under ‘AW’, a tropical savanna climate with a dry winter. It rains heavily during the monsoon season, which is the off-season for tourists in Mahabaleshwar. The humidity is 90-95%, and it rains on average 20 days a month between June and September. While this makes the hill station look ravishing, moving around can be difficult. You can find easy and affordable accommodation in the off-season, but many activities are shut down, leaving you to plan adventures on your own. Mahabaleshwar's many serene lakes and gushing waterfalls come to life in the monsoon season, further enhancing its beauty.

    Winter Season in Mahabaleshwar

    Winter in Mahabaleshwar lasts from November to February. During this time, visitors can feel the cool breezes and a mild chill in the air. The temperature remains between 15 degrees and 28 degrees Celsius, and carrying a light jacket or shawl will be enough to keep you comfortable and cosy. This is an ideal time for newlyweds, honeymooners, and couples, as they can cherish some snuggles and romance with their significant other. It is the peak tourist season and the best time to visit Mahabaleshwar. The weather is incredibly pleasant, and visitors can go sightseeing without worrying about rain or sun. Winter is also the time of strawberry harvests. You can go fruit-picking, buy authentic jams and marmalades straight from the orchards, and enjoy the many ways strawberries are prepared in the local cuisine.

    FAQ's of Mahabaleshwar

    Read on to find out why our customers love us!

    Winter is the best season to visit Mahabaleshwar. During the colder months of the year, the hill station acquires a sheen of elegance and a romantic atmosphere. The weather is dry and pleasant, making it perfect for a good outdoor holiday.

    The off-season is during the monsoon, and Mahabaleshwar peak season is in winter, from November to February.

    The best time to visit Mahabaleshwar with family is during the shoulder season. You will find fewer crowds and cheaper accommodation. Moreover, the summer months are pleasant enough in weather, and one can take part in trekking, boating, and sightseeing, without any unnecessary hassles.
